Lester’s Surprising Appearance in GTA Online

The mastermind behind Grand Theft Auto’s most complex heists has unexpectedly surfaced as a playable character model within GTA Online sessions, creating both amusement and controversy among the community.

Veteran players across both story mode and online environments instantly recognize Lester Crest as the strategic genius orchestrating major criminal operations from behind the scenes. His sudden transition from mission coordinator to active participant marks a dramatic departure from his established role within the game’s universe.

While this character transformation isn’t part of any official Rockstar Games update, clever players have discovered methods to replace their avatar’s appearance with Lester’s distinctive model. The resulting visual incongruity has generated both laughter and confusion during heist preparations and free roam activities.

The sight of Lester’s character model demonstrating unexpected mobility and participating directly in combat scenarios creates a surreal experience for unsuspecting teammates. Imagine preparing for a sophisticated bank robbery only to discover your crew includes the very person who normally plans such operations from a secure location.

Documentation of these unusual appearances briefly surfaced on gaming forums before moderators removed the content, likely due to the unauthorized methods used to achieve the character transformation.

  • How Players Are Achieving This Character Transformation

    The player responsible for the widely-shared Lester appearance utilized the username “RockstarManager,” which immediately raised suspicions about legitimate acquisition methods. This naming choice strongly suggests the involvement of third-party modification tools or exploitation of game vulnerabilities.

    Character reskinning typically requires specialized modding software that alters game files to replace standard player models with NPC appearances. These modifications operate outside Rockstar’s intended gameplay parameters and violate the terms of service governing GTA Online.

    Forum moderators routinely remove content showcasing these unauthorized modifications to comply with platform policies and discourage imitation. The rapid deletion of the Lester appearance post demonstrates consistent enforcement against modding-related content across community platforms.

    Advanced players should note that Rockstar’s anti-cheat systems have become increasingly sophisticated at detecting character model manipulation. Attempting similar modifications now carries higher risks of detection compared to previous game iterations.

  • Why Rockstar Limits Character Customization Options

    Despite offering hundreds of legitimate clothing items and appearance options, Rockstar deliberately restricts players from adopting the likenesses of major story characters. This design choice serves multiple important purposes within the game’s ecosystem.

    Narrative consistency represents a primary concern, as Lester appears extensively in missions across both single-player and online modes. Having multiple identical characters participating in cutscenes would create logical contradictions and break immersion during carefully crafted story moments.

    Technical limitations also play a significant role in these restrictions. Story characters often possess unique animations, voice lines, and interaction patterns that wouldn’t translate properly to player-controlled avatars. The game engine may struggle to handle these specialized assets in unpredictable player scenarios.

    From a gameplay perspective, maintaining clear visual distinction between NPCs and players helps prevent confusion during cooperative missions. Instant recognition of teammate identities becomes crucial when coordinating complex heist strategies under time pressure.

    Risks and Consequences of Character Modding

    Attempting to modify character appearances through unauthorized methods carries severe consequences that every GTA Online player should understand before considering such actions.

    Account suspension represents the most immediate risk, with Rockstar issuing temporary bans for first offenses and permanent account termination for repeat violations. Players invested hundreds of hours developing their characters could lose everything permanently.

    Security concerns extend beyond game penalties, as many modding tools originate from unverified sources that may contain malware or data harvesting software. Players risk compromising their personal information and system security when downloading these unauthorized applications.

    The gaming experience itself suffers when modding becomes prevalent, creating unbalanced matches and undermining the achievements of players who progress through legitimate means. Community trust deteriorates when players cannot distinguish between earned accomplishments and modded advantages.
